Or anyone who knows for certain...
Besides the power cord itself, is any of the wire heavier than 20 AWG in the AC and DC power supplies? I have 18 on the power tube heaters, 20 to the preamp heaters and 20 in the signal path. I did a search, but no answers about the power supply.
